Abstract

This research aimed at finding out the effect of using English talk show video on increasing student listening comprehension at the tenth grade of Islamic Integrated Senior High School of Fadhilah Pekanbaru.  Pre-experimental design was used in this research with one experimental class given a talk show as a treatment.  Data were collected through pretest and posttest with student worksheets compiled based on the indicators of the ability to understand the gist or general overview of the text listened to, the ability to understand main ideas or important information, the ability to understand specific information and remember important details, the ability to understand the speaker attitude or meaning toward the listener or the topic discussed, and the ability to understand implied meaning through inference and deduction from spoken information.  The research findings showed an increase in the mean score from 32.67 in the pretest to 66.67 in the posttest.  Analyzing data with paired sample t-test yielded the score of significance 0.000 (<0.05), so it indicated a significant difference in student listening comprehension between before and after the treatment.  Thus, it could be concluded that there was a significant effect of using talk show video on increasing student listening comprehension.  This research recommended the use of talk show video as an effective and enjoyable learning medium in English learning at Senior High School level.
